The African American Jewish Coalition is a unique community group. It is an unaffiliated, grass roots, non-religious and diverse group which actively promotes, teaches and practices brotherhood among Jewish Americans and African Americans. Its community-wide programs espouse racial harmony and instill pride, acceptance and peace in those who attend. Through active involvement members strive to dispel prejudices and highlight all that is good in our urban/suburban community, thereby strengthening African American and Jewish American ties.
